  • The objective of this study was to estimate the dynamic behavior of a personal rapid transit(PRT) track system using a rail of rectangular tube section and a rail joint of sliding type, and to compare the results with the normal rail and rail joint of a PRT track system by performing field measurements using actual vehicles running along the service lines. The measured vertical displacement of rail and sleeper, and vertical acceleration of rail for the normal rail and rail joint section were found to be similar, and the rail joint of sliding type satisfied the design specifications of the track impact factor for a conventional railway track. The experimental results showed that the overall dynamic response of the rail joint were found to be similar to or less than that of the normal rail, therefore the rail joint of sliding type for PRT track system was sufficient to ensure a stability and safety of PRT track system.

  • In this study, the track-bridge interaction analysis was performed using an analytical model considering the track structure, thereby taking into account the linear conditions (R=650 m, cant variation $160{\pm}60mm$) and the dynamic characteristics of the bridge. As a result of the study, the allowable speed on the example bridge considered was calculated at 200 km/h based on vertical deflection, vertical acceleration, and irregularity in longitudinal level, but was also evaluated at 170km/h based on the coefficient of derailment, wheel load reduction, and lateral displacement of the rail head. It is considered desirable to set the speed 170km/h to the speed limit in order to secure the safety of both the bridge and the track. It is judged that there will be no problems with ensuring rail protection and train stability in the speed band.

  • In this study, subway train vibration has been measured to characterize the whole body vibration of Seoul subway lines for various human postures. Results show that the floor vibration level of the subway trains in the vertical direction is higher than that in other directions. At the standing human posture, vibration level of the head in the right-left direction are increased while that in the vertical direction is decreased. It is assumed that the different flexibility of the human body and the rolling motion of the subway trains are the main cause. At the sitting posture with back seat on, vibration level in the right and left direction at the human ischial tuberosities is lower than that in other directions. Results also show that there were little difference between back-seat on model and back-seat off model. Transmissibility analysis shows how the subway vibration affects the response of a human body.

  • The seismic characteristics with 3-Dimensional isolation systems have been studied using a shaking table system. In this study, we made nuclear power plant main control room floor systems and several seismic shaking table tests with and without isolation systems were conducted to evaluate floor isolation effectiveness. Isolation systems have showed large reduction effectiveness in acceleration and response spectra with x and z direction respectively, but horizontal isolation is more effective than vertical one It is required to make isolation systems of which design frequency is below 1Hz when applied to main control room of NPP, but considering much difficulties in making such isolation systems, it is recommended that much consideration should be taken into account when applied to main control room of NPP.

  • The 2017 Pohang earthquake afflicted more significant economic losses than the 2016 Gyeongju earthquake, even if these earthquakes had a similar moment magnitude. This phenomenon could be due to local site conditions that amplify ground motions. Local site effects could be estimated from methods using the horizontal-to-vertical spectral ratio, standard spectral ratio, and the generalized inversion technique. Since the generalized inversion method could estimate the site effect effectively, this study modeled the site effects in the Korean peninsula using the generalized inversion technique and the Fourier amplitude spectrum of ground motions. To validate the method, the site effects estimated for seismic stations were tested using recorded ground motions, and a ground motion prediction equation was developed without considering site effects.
